TOMB OF THE UNKNOWN SOLDIER"Almighty God, our gracious Father: in simple faith and trust we seek Thy blessing. Help us fittingly to honor our unknown soldiers who gave their all in laying sure foundations of international commenweal. Help us to keep clear the obligation we have toward all worthy soldiers, living and dead, that their sacrifices and their valor fade not from our memory. Temper our sorrow, we pray Thee, through the assurance, which came from the sweetest lips that ever uttered words, 'Blessed are they that mourn, for they shall be comforted.' Be Thou our comforter. "Facing the events on the morrow, when from the work bench of the world there will be taken an unusual task, we ask Thou wilt accord exceptional judgement, foresight and tactfulness of approach to those who seek to bring about a discord, which provokes war, may disappear that there may be world tranquility. "Hear us, O Lord, as now, in obedience to the call of our President, there sounds throughout the land the national Angels calling to prayer, and we stand with bowed heads and reverent hearts in silent thanks for the valor and valorous lives and in supplication for divine mercy and blessing upon our beloved country: And upon the nations of the earth and to Thee, Wonderful Counselor, Mighty God, Everlasting Father, Prince of Peace, shall be ascribed all glory and honor forever. Amen." |
